Max Originals The Penguin and Dune: Prophecy are heading to HBO

Max Originals The Penguin and Dune: Prophecy are heading to HBO

After Harry Potter and Welcome to Derry, the exclusive Max Originals The Penguin and Dune: Prophecy are now also going to HBO.
Last month, Warner Bros. moved Discovery brought three of its highest-profile Max Originals – Harry Potter, Lanterns and IT prequel series Welcome to Derry – to HBO Originals. The company is now continuing this shift with the relocation of The Penguin and Dune: Prophecy.

Both series are now premiering on HBO and will also launch on the HBO Max streaming service.

It's part of a strategy to transform its best-known titles into HBO Originals, allowing them to be broadcast linearly on the premium cable network as well as streamed. When the move was revealed in June, the company said it was unsure whether The Penguin, which premieres in September, and Dune: Prophecy would fall under the new brand, but this has now been clarified.

WBD said last month that HBO Max original series Harry Potter and Welcome to Derry are moving to HBO. The Green Lanterns series Lanterns is also part of this strategic move after receiving a series order from HBO.

The Penguin stars Colin Farrell. Developed by Lauren LeFranc, Farrell will reprise his role as the gangster from Matt Reeves' The Batman in Gotham City. Cristin Milioti, Rhenzy Feliz, Theo Rossi, Michael Kelly, Shohreh Aghdashloo, Deirdre O'Connell, Clancy Brown and Michael Zegen also star.

The series comes from Reeves' 6th & Idaho Productions and Dylan Clark Productions in association with Warner Bros. Television and DC Studios, with Reeves, Farrell, LeFranc, Clark, Bill Carraro and Daniel Pipski serving as executive producers. LeFranc is showrunner and Craig Zobel directs the first three episodes.

Meanwhile, Dune: Prophecy was ordered five years ago and is expected later this year.

Dune: Prophecy (also known as Dune: The Sisterhood) comes from the Dune expanded universe created by author Frank Herbert and is set 10,000 years before the ascension of Paul Atreides. It is inspired by the novel Sisterhood of Dune, written by Brian Herbert and Kevin J. Anderson. It follows two Harkonnen sisters as they battle forces that threaten the future of humanity and found the legendary sect that will become known as the Bene Gesserit.

The series, which underwent some major casting, writing and directing changes during a pandemic and strikes, stars Emily Watson, Olivia Williams, Travis Fimmel, Jodhi May, Mark Strong, Sarah-Sofie Boussnina, Josh Heuston, Chloe Lea, Jade Anouka , Faoileann Cunningham, Edward Davis, Aoife Hinds, Chris Mason, Shalom Brune-Franklin, Jihae, Tabu, Charithra Chandran, Jessica Barden, Emma Canning and Yerin Ha in the cast.

Alison Schapker is showrunner and executive producer. Diane Ademu-John, who is among those who left early, co-developed the series and serves as executive producer. Anna Foerster produced and directed several episodes, including the first.

Jordan Goldberg, Mark Tobey, John Cameron, Matthew King, Scott Z. Burns and Jon Spaihts produce with author Brian Herbert and Byron Merritt and Kim Herbert serve as executive producers for the estate of Frank Herbert. Author Kevin J. Anderson is co-producer. Legendary is co-producer.
